The Singer Heavy Duty 4423 sewing machine is praised for its lightweight design, ease of use, and versatility, making it suitable for both beginners and experienced sewers. Many guests appreciate its ability to handle various fabrics, including heavier materials, and the inclusion of essential accessories. However, some guests have reported issues with thread tension and mechanical reliability, which may affect overall satisfaction. Despite these concerns, the machine remains a popular choice for its performance and value.

Poorly made
Straight out of the box, the shaft where needle is inserted was misaligned, even with the dial set to the right the needle was not perpendicular. Lifting the presser foot, the lifter tab hit the housing when raised to get extra height. I took off the cover and the lifter mechanism also hits a screw holding in the upper thread guide. I tried a dozen different needles, bought brand new high quality thread, changed bobbins, different fabrics, settings, and still couldn't get a consistent nice stitch. I couldn't sew at night it would wake up my toddler way down the hall door closed it was so clunky and loud.

Don't Buy, poorly made garbage
This machine is a cheap piece of garbage. I purchased my Singer Heavy Duty 4432 machine at the end of last year. I don't use a sewing machine often, but I needed to upgrade and assumed that this machine would be suitable for my purposes. This past week, a project came up that required some sewing and I was excited to finally put my machine to use. Literally the first time I went to fill the bobbin, a plastic piece inside the machine broke. I was forced to rig the bobbin to my electric drill just to get through the job. Now, when I go to look up the warranty, I discover that it's only good for 90 days on mechanical parts. This brand new machine that I've used exactly once has already broken and apparently, if I want to even bother to fix it, I'm on my own. Is this what Singer has come to? I always considered Singer to be a trusted brand that builds quality sewing machines, but if this is what I can expect, then this will be the last machine I buy from them.
